D'Urville Island
6-day tour
Experience Rangitoto Ki Te Tonga - D'Urville Island, located in the Marlborough Sounds, South Island, NZ
A once-in-a-lifetime trip to D'Urville Island, in the remote reaches of the Marlborough Sounds. Travel by private 4WD vehicle over private farm roads, on a ferry vessel through the infamous waters of French Pass and in a small plane for a stunning overview of the island and its surrounds.
Try your hand at fishing for Blue Cod, and watch for Dolphins, Fern Birds and endemic King Shags as you explore the beautiful coastline.
​
And along the way, make the most of connecting with the locals, to hear stories from life on the island, and the history of bygone days.
​
Due to the remoteness and difficulty in getting this isolated island, this tour is limited to seven guests and we have two guides to ensure your safety and comfort.

Molesworth & Rainbow High Country
6-day tour
Visit the iconic Molesworth & Rainbow Stations, located in the Marlborough and North Canterbury region, South Island, NZ
The Molesworth Station is New Zealand's largest high country farm. Covering almost half a million acres, it is roughly the size of Stewart Island.
​
Traverse the breadth of this vast landscape, visiting family vineyards, historic sites and get a glimpse into what working the land here really means.
​
From the green forests and blue waters of Lake Rotoiti in the north, to the golden hues of autumn in the high country. Join us for a unique perspective of this iconic landscape, and meet the friendly farmers and locals who bring it to life.
